TECHNICAL FIELD The present invention relates to a method for producing a cement board, and more specifically,
For example, the present invention relates to a method for producing a cement board used for a roof tile by giving a natural and varied draining shape.

Conventionally, when manufacturing roof tiles with cement boards,
As shown in FIG. 4, while the raw cement raw material plate A is being conveyed in the form of a belt by the belt conveyor B, it is cut along the cutting lines a and b by the roll cutter and the product material C as shown by the chain line in FIG. After the primary curing of this material C,
Press punching into the solid line shape in Fig. 5 and paint it,
Moreover, the final curing was performed to obtain a cement board D as a product.

In that case, since the peripheral portion E of the product material C comes into contact with the CO 2 gas in the atmosphere during curing in the press punching, efflorescence occurs, so that this part is cut off for the purpose of improving product quality. The shape of the water draining portion F of the cement board D is changed so that the roofing pattern on the roof surface is changed by the water draining portion.

However, the cement board D obtained by the above conventional method
Then, since the shape of the water draining portion F formed by press punching is standardized and becomes the same shape in all the cement plates D, the line of the water draining portion generated on the roof surface is fixed, and in the thatching pattern, There is no variability, and it is not possible to give the roof surface a variety of expressions.

On the other hand, at the stage of cutting the band-shaped material A in FIG. 4 to obtain the product material C, the cutter blade portion corresponding to the water draining portion of the roll cutter used for the cutting is provided with an irregular shape in advance. Therefore, it is conceivable that the product materials having different draining shapes are continuously formed one by one with the above cutting. However, in such a method, the draining portion cannot be cut off in the press punching after the curing, so that there is a problem that the white flower phenomenon occurring in the draining portion cannot be dealt with.

In view of the above problems, the present invention cuts the end portion of the cement plate into an irregular shape at the stage of molding the product material, but does not cut off the end portion at the press punching step. The object of the present invention is to provide a method for manufacturing a cement board, which can prevent deterioration of product quality due to a phenomenon.

That is, in the method for producing a cement plate of the present invention, with respect to the cement raw raw plate continuously supplied in a strip shape, after applying an anti-whitening agent on both side edges of the raw raw plate, the raw raw plate is subjected to a predetermined strip direction. It is characterized in that it is roughly cut for each dimension, and the product material obtained by this cutting is naturally cured and then cut into the product shape except for the part to which the anti-whitening agent is applied.

As shown in FIG. 1, the method for manufacturing a cement board according to the present invention is a process in which a belt-shaped cement raw material board 1 is conveyed by a belt conveyor 2 at both side edges of the raw material board 1 (a drainage of the cement board as a roof tile). Part) 1a, 1a, about 30
After applying an anti-white flower agent 3 such as a water-based paint (emulsion paint) or an eflation inhibitor (aqueous fluorinated solution, acrylic emulsion) with a width of up to 50 mm, the raw plate 1
Is roughly cut by a roll cutter (not shown) along the cutting lines a and b at a predetermined interval in the strip-like direction, and is cut on both sides 1a by a cutting line c having an irregular shape as shown in FIG. Then, the product material 4 (chain line portion in FIG. 2) is molded, and after natural curing, the product material 4 is press-punched into a product shape shown by a solid line except for the part to which the anti-whitening agent is applied.

According to the above method, at the stage of molding the product material 4,
Since the whitening preventive agent 3 is applied to the part of the cement plate 5 that becomes the draining part 6, the whitening does not occur in the draining part 6 in the curing state, and the draining part is used at the stage of press punching the product material 4. No need to cut off. For this reason, when the product material 4 is molded, the cement cutter 5 having an irregular draining shape can be continuously produced by cutting the draining portion 6 in an irregular shape with a roll cutter. When the roof surface is covered with the plate 5, it is possible to subtly change the roofing pattern as shown in FIG.

Since the present invention is configured as described above, it is possible to continuously manufacture a cement board having a cutting end surface such as a draining portion that changes irregularly, and eliminate the white sinter that accompanies the deterioration of product quality in the board material. be able to. For this reason, for example, when the cement board is used as a roof tile, there is an effect that the roofing pattern can be delicately changed by the irregularly shaped draining portion, and the expression of the roof surface can be variously changed.
